Exploring the World of RMIT Software Engineering: Bridging Theory and Practice
The World of RMIT Software Engineering
RMIT University offers a cutting-edge Software Engineering program that equips students with the skills and knowledge needed to thrive in the dynamic field of software development.
Why Choose RMIT for Software Engineering?
RMIT stands out for its industry-focused curriculum that combines theoretical learning with hands-on experience. Students have access to state-of-the-art facilities and are taught by experienced professionals who are actively involved in the tech industry.
Key Features of the Program
- Practical Projects: Students work on real-world projects that simulate industry scenarios, allowing them to apply their knowledge in a practical setting.
- Industry Connections: RMIT has strong ties with leading tech companies, providing students with networking opportunities and potential pathways to internships and job placements.
- Specialization Options: The program offers various specialization tracks, such as software development, cybersecurity, mobile app development, and more, allowing students to tailor their studies to their interests.
- Cutting-Edge Technologies: Students learn about the latest technologies and tools used in the software engineering field, ensuring they stay ahead of industry trends.
- Career Support: RMIT provides career guidance and support services to help students transition smoothly into the workforce upon graduation.
Career Opportunities for RMIT Software Engineering Graduates
RMIT Software Engineering graduates are well-equipped to pursue diverse career paths in the tech industry. They can work as software developers, systems analysts, IT consultants, project managers, cybersecurity specialists, and more. The demand for skilled software engineers continues to grow across various sectors, making this a promising career choice for aspiring technologists.
In conclusion, RMIT’s Software Engineering program offers a comprehensive education that prepares students for success in the ever-evolving world of technology. With a focus on practical skills, industry connections, and cutting-edge knowledge, graduates emerge as confident professionals ready to make an impact in the digital landscape.
Top 5 Benefits of RMIT’s Software Engineering Program: Industry Focus, Real-World Experience, and More
- Industry-focused curriculum
- Hands-on experience with real-world projects
- Strong industry connections for networking and career opportunities
- Specialization options in various tech fields
- Access to cutting-edge technologies and tools
Challenges of Pursuing Software Engineering at RMIT: Key Concerns for Students
- High Tuition Fees
- Heavy Workload
- Limited Elective Options
- Competitive Environment
- Limited Practical Experience
- Potential for Outdated Curriculum
Industry-focused curriculum
The industry-focused curriculum of RMIT’s Software Engineering program sets it apart by providing students with practical, real-world learning experiences that mirror the challenges and demands of the tech industry. By integrating industry-relevant projects, case studies, and guest lectures from professionals, students gain valuable insights and skills that directly translate to their future careers. This hands-on approach ensures that graduates are well-prepared to navigate the complexities of the software engineering field and make an immediate impact in the industry upon graduation.
Hands-on experience with real-world projects
One of the key advantages of RMIT’s Software Engineering program is the emphasis on hands-on experience through real-world projects. By working on practical assignments that mirror industry scenarios, students gain valuable skills and insights that go beyond theoretical knowledge. This approach not only enhances their problem-solving abilities but also prepares them to tackle challenges they may encounter in their future careers as software engineers. The opportunity to apply classroom learning to actual projects equips RMIT students with a competitive edge and a deeper understanding of the complexities of software development in a professional setting.
Strong industry connections for networking and career opportunities
RMIT’s Software Engineering program stands out for its strong industry connections, providing students with invaluable networking opportunities and paving the way for promising career prospects. Through collaborations with leading tech companies, students can engage with industry professionals, gain insights into real-world practices, and potentially secure internships or job placements. These connections not only enhance the academic experience but also offer a direct pathway for students to establish themselves in the competitive tech industry upon graduation.
Specialization options in various tech fields
RMIT’s Software Engineering program stands out for its diverse specialization options in various tech fields. Students have the opportunity to tailor their studies to their specific interests and career goals by choosing tracks such as software development, cybersecurity, mobile app development, and more. This flexibility allows students to delve deep into their preferred areas of expertise, gaining specialized knowledge and skills that are highly sought after in the tech industry. By offering a range of specialization options, RMIT ensures that graduates are well-prepared to excel in their chosen field upon completing the program.
Access to cutting-edge technologies and tools
RMIT Software Engineering program provides students with a significant advantage by granting access to cutting-edge technologies and tools. This exposure enables students to stay abreast of the latest advancements in the field, preparing them to tackle real-world challenges with confidence and innovation. By working with state-of-the-art resources, students can enhance their skills and develop a deep understanding of industry-relevant technologies, positioning them as competitive professionals in the ever-evolving landscape of software engineering.
High Tuition Fees
The RMIT Software Engineering program, while offering exceptional education and opportunities, may pose a financial challenge for some students due to its high tuition fees. The cost of attending the program can be a deterrent for individuals seeking quality education but facing financial constraints. It is important for prospective students to carefully consider their financial situation and explore available scholarships or financial aid options to make informed decisions regarding their educational pursuits.
Heavy Workload
The Software Engineering program at RMIT University is known to present a challenge in the form of a heavy workload. Students enrolled in the program often find themselves juggling multiple assignments, projects, and deadlines, which can be demanding. To succeed in this environment, students must learn to effectively manage their time and prioritize tasks to ensure they meet the rigorous academic requirements of the program. The heavy workload serves as a test of resilience and time management skills, preparing students for the fast-paced nature of the tech industry upon graduation.
Limited Elective Options
Some students pursuing RMIT’s Software Engineering program may encounter a con in the form of limited elective options. While the program provides a strong foundation in software engineering principles, some individuals might feel constrained by the lack of diverse elective courses to choose from. This limitation could potentially restrict students’ ability to explore specific areas of interest or tailor their studies to align with their career goals. It is important for students to carefully consider this aspect and assess whether the available elective options adequately meet their academic and professional needs within the program.
Competitive Environment
In the realm of RMIT Software Engineering, one notable challenge lies in the competitive academic environment fostered by the high caliber of students at the university. The rigorous standards and talent pool can create a highly competitive atmosphere, pushing students to strive for excellence and continuously elevate their skills. While this environment can be demanding, it also serves as a catalyst for growth and encourages students to push their boundaries, fostering a culture of innovation and achievement within the program.
Limited Practical Experience
Some students enrolled in RMIT’s Software Engineering program may encounter a con related to limited practical experience. Although the program incorporates practical projects, there might be a perception among some students that additional hands-on opportunities could significantly enrich their learning experience. Expanding the scope of hands-on activities could potentially bridge the gap between theoretical knowledge and real-world application, providing students with a more comprehensive skill set and better preparing them for the challenges of the software engineering industry.
Potential for Outdated Curriculum
In the realm of RMIT Software Engineering, a notable concern revolves around the potential for an outdated curriculum. Given the fast-paced nature of the software engineering industry, there exists a risk that certain aspects of the program’s curriculum could lag behind current trends and advancements. This drawback underscores the importance of continuous curriculum review and updates to ensure that students are equipped with the most relevant and up-to-date knowledge and skills needed to thrive in today’s dynamic tech landscape.